Policymakers and program managers are continually seeking ways to improve accountability in achieving an entity's mission. A key factor in improving accountability in achieving an entity's mission is to implement an effective internal control system. An effective internal control system helps an entity adapt to shifting environments, evolving demands, changing risks, and new priorities. As programs change and entities strive to improve operational processes and implement new technology, management continually evaluates its internal control system so that it is effective and updated when necessary. Section 3512 (c) and (d) of Title 31 of the United States Code (commonly known as the Federal Managers' Financial Integrity Act (FMFIA)) requires the Comptroller General to issue standards for internal control in the federal government.

"The Bureau of Information Resource Management (IRM), headed by the Chief Information Officer (CIO), who holds the rank of an Assistant Secretary, serves as the "home bureau" for Foreign Service Information Technology (IT) employees. Although many of the Foreign Service IT positions in the department are held by other bureaus, IRM sought a competency study encompassing all Foreign Service IT professionals in the department. This study seeks to determine whether these professionals have the knowledge, skills, and abilities to meet the department's current and future information management needs, as well as to develop actionable, data-driven strategies to improve how IRM recruits, trains, and develops, and retains members of the Foreign Service IT workforce"--Page iii.
